    I went to my unit to find my lock gone and a facility lock on my unit (the red circular ones). I called the service number and was told that they had no notes showing that the facility had put their lock on my unit. I was told that the first availability for someone to come remove the lock was 4 days later. I requested an investigation and was told I would receive a call in 4 days. After the 4 days, there was no call. I called again and asked for a supervisor. They do not transfer you to a supervisor and instead take your number and call you back. I received a call back about 30 minutes later. At first, he said that the facility management had noticed that my lock was gone and placed the red lock to secure my unit. Then he said they did NOT place the red lock and the investigation was internal and I would not know the outcome. Then was told I should’ve called the police when I saw the lock was gone… He said the bottom line was my lock would not be replaced because I didn’t call the police and the investigation was none of my business. This facility is obviously not secured and your things are not safe. Customer service will not help you. Edit- the response below asks me to call. I called the number provided and was told that there is no notes in my account for me to call and she could not help me. Again, horrible customer service. If “Red dot owner” is truly interested in resolving my issue, my name is listed above and my phone number is on my account. ... Read more

    My unit was broken into at some point within the last 2 months, only found out today. Had a lot of stuff stolen and other things damaged. Main gate has been stuck open for 2 weeks now (from what police have said) and theres not enough cameras on the facility to monitor. Unit next to mine was unlocked and thiefs broke through the walls into mine and unit next to it (walls are sectioned pieces of fiberglass). No employees or managers on site. Was told just to file insurance claim and police report. Not recommended to store. *update: according to police and facility personnel, cameras havent worked for over 18 months with 22 thefts happening within the facility and the home office for Red Dot is aware of their faulty equipment but havent fixed them since. The home office has also been negligent in their regular duties and multiple personnel have been laid off for this issue but little to no resolve for any issues that have been addressed. ...     The right storage unit size depends on what you plan to store and how much space you need to move around your items.

    5x5 or 5x10 units are great for smaller loads, such as chairs, lamps, small furniture pieces, boxes, books, and documents.

    10x10 or 10x15 units work well for larger furniture, bicycles, appliances, and the contents of a small apartment.

    10x20 or 10x30 units can typically fit the contents of a three-bedroom home, including large furniture and multiple appliances.

    If you’re unsure which size is best, a unit size calculator can help estimate the right fit based on the items you’re planning to store – helping you avoid paying for more space than you need.

    Climate-controlled storage units maintain consistent temperature and humidity levels, helping protect items from damage caused by heat, cold, or excess moisture.

    You may want climate control if you’re storing items that can be sensitive to temperature changes, such as furniture, clothing, appliances, paperwork, photographs, artwork, electronics, or wood and leather goods. These units are especially useful for long-term storage or in areas with hot summers, cold winters, or high humidity.

    If you’re storing durable items like tools or outdoor gear, a standard unit may be sufficient. When in doubt, climate control offers added protection and peace of mind.
